Messi, De Bruyne, Eriksen, Odegaard: The world's top 10 playmakers named

Lionel Messi is finally producing the form that Paris Saint-Germain fans were dreaming of when he signed for the club last year.

A difficult first season adapting to life post-Barcelona is now firmly in the rear-view mirror with the seven-time Ballon d’Or winner starting to show exactly the sort of form that he displayed at Camp Nou since turning 30.

His numbers might not be quite as spine-tingling as they used to be, but a record of eight goals and eight assists from just 13 games so far this season is nevertheless pretty frightening for a 35-year-old.

However, while it's great to see Messi finding the back of the net on a much more regular basis once again, it's the assist total that we're interested in today because the Argentine's playmaking has been particularly special this season.

Messi has always had an eye for a spectacular pass in his later years, but you've only had to watch him in action for just a couple of minutes during the 2022/23 campaign to know that his creativity has been truly out of this world recently.

The likes of Kylian Mbappe and Neymar really have been spoilt for chances because watching PSG this season has practically been a footballing clinic in Messi spraying passes here, there and everywhere.
